Comparison With Traditional Paint Markings
Thermoplastic striping differs significantly from traditional paint markings. While paint is typically water-based and requires frequent maintenance, thermoplastic materials are designed for durability. Thermoplastic becomes pliable when heated, allowing it to adhere effectively to the pavement.
Key benefits of thermoplastic striping include:
Longevity: Thermoplastic can last 5 to 7 years, significantly outlasting standard paint.
Reflectivity: The addition of glass beads enhances visibility at night.
Cost-effectiveness: Reduced need for frequent touch-ups results in lower long-term costs.

Key Components of Thermoplastic Material
Thermoplastic striping comprises several essential components that contribute to its effectiveness. The primary ingredients include pigments, binders, and glass beads.
Pigments: These provide the desired color for the markings.
Binders: Binders hold the material together and enhance adhesion to surfaces.
Glass beads: These are embedded within the material to improve reflectivity, making stripes visible in low-light conditions.
Together, these components create a robust and reliable marking solution. Durability and Longevity
One of the standout features of thermoplastic striping is its exceptional durability. Made from high-quality materials, it resists cracking, chipping, and shattering, even under heavy traffic conditions. This resilience results from the unique bonding process and the inclusion of glass beads, which add strength and stability.
In terms of longevity, thermoplastic striping significantly outlasts traditional paint. While paint may require frequent reapplication, thermoplastic can maintain its clarity and integrity for many years. This extended lifespan ultimately translates to lower maintenance costs, providing excellent value for your investment.

Environmental Considerations
When choosing materials for striping, environmental impact is an important factor. Thermoplastic striping is formulated with fewer volatile organic compounds (VOCs) compared to traditional paint. This makes it a more environmentally friendly option, contributing to better air quality.
Additionally, its long lifespan reduces the frequency of reapplication, which means less waste and lower resource consumption over time. By opting for thermoplastic striping, you align your business with sustainable practices while ensuring your parking lot remains both functional and eco-friendly.

Application Process and Equipment
The application of thermoplastic striping requires careful preparation and the right equipment to ensure durability and visibility. Understanding the surface preparation, heating methods, and specialized equipment involved is essential for achieving optimal results.
Surface Preparation
Before applying thermoplastic material, proper surface preparation is crucial. Ensure the pavement is clean, dry, and free from debris. A scarifier may be used to remove any existing tape, paint, or loose material. This helps the new thermoplastic adhere effectively to the surface.
Additionally, the surface should be inspected for cracks or damages that may require repair before striping. The temperature should also be monitored, as applying thermoplastic in unsuitable conditions could impair its performance. Taking these preparatory steps can significantly improve the longevity of the markings.
Heating and Applying the Material
Heating the thermoplastic material is a critical part of the application process. The material must be heated to a temperature between 400°F to 440°F for proper application. A premelt kettle is typically used for this purpose, ensuring that the material reaches the necessary viscosity.
Once heated, the thermoplastic can be applied using specialized equipment. Timing is important—you must apply the material promptly after heating to avoid cooling and hardening. The application should be uniform to create clear and distinct line markings. Ensuring the right ambient conditions during application will greatly enhance the quality and durability of the striping.
Specialized Application Equipment
Utilizing the right application equipment is key to successful thermoplastic striping. Line stripers designed specifically for thermoplastic applications will ensure a precise and uniform application. These machines can often be adjusted for different line widths based on your project requirements.

Preformed Thermoplastic Options
Preformed thermoplastic options are ideal for quick application and consistent results. These markings come in pre-cut shapes and can be easily installed onto clean, dry surfaces.
Advantages include:
Time Efficiency: Saves labor time as they can be applied without extensive preparation.
Durability: Offers long-lasting performance, even in high-traffic areas.
Flexibility: Suitable for intricate designs required for different applications.
You can find preformed options for crosswalks, arrows, and symbols, ensuring high visibility. Many contractors prefer these for their reliability and ease of use, making them a popular choice in parking lots and roadways. What are the benefits and drawbacks of using thermoplastic for road striping?
Thermoplastic offers significant durability and is highly visible, making it ideal for high-traffic areas. It dries quickly and can withstand harsher weather better than traditional paint.
However, installation costs are higher, and the material may require specialized equipment. You should consider these factors based on your specific requirements.
How does thermoplastic striping compare to traditional road paint in terms of longevity and cost?
Thermoplastic typically lasts longer than standard road paint, often exceeding three to five years under normal conditions. While the initial investment is higher, the extended lifespan can provide better long-term value.
Traditional paint may be less expensive upfront but often requires more frequent reapplication in busy areas, which can increase overall costs.
What is the typical lifespan of thermoplastic striping under normal traffic conditions?
Under normal traffic conditions, thermoplastic striping can last anywhere from three to seven years. Factors like traffic volume and environmental conditions play a role in its longevity.
For optimal performance, regular inspections and maintenance are recommended to address any wear and tear.
Can existing thermoplastic striping be overlaid with paint, and if so, how does it affect durability?
Yes, you can overlay existing thermoplastic striping with paint. However, this can affect durability, as paint may wear off more quickly than thermoplastic.
It's important to ensure that the surface is properly prepared and the materials are compatible to maximize the effectiveness of the paint.
